Sergio García , born the January 9th 1980 with Castellón of Planed, is a Golf Spanish or
Called El Niño , it begins the golf very early. It obtains to its first results while becoming at 14 years the youngest player of the history to pass the cut in a tournament of the Circuit European. The same year, he becomes also the youngest winner of the European championship amateur.
Passed professional in 1999 just after having carried out the low score of an amateur to the Masters, it obtains what remains still its best result in a tournament of the Grand Slam with one 2nd place with USPGA 1999 after a formidable duel with Tiger Woods at the time of the last turn. The same year, it gains its first tournaments over the European circuit and becomes the youngest golfor to be taken part in the Ryder Cup. It contributes enormously to the three victories in the following editions of 2002, 2004 and 2006. Its assessment is eloquent besides: 10 shared victories, 3 defeats, 2 parts.
In 2001, it gains its first tournaments over the circuit PGA, circuit where it plays from now on in priority.
July 22nd, 2007, it lets escape the victory which seemed to him promised in British Open of Carnoustie (Scotland). After having carried out during the 4 days of the tournament, a series of missed blows place it at equality with the Irishman Padraig Harrington, who finally carries it at the conclusion of the play-off.
